Crescent Point Drills 251 Wells in Q3; Reports D&C Capex of $423.7MM

Crescent Point reported its Q3 results. Highlights include: 

Increased production guidance for 2017 average daily production to 175,500 boe/d from 174,500 boe/d Average daily production in Q3 was 176,609 boe/d, an increase of more than 15,000 boe/d in Q3 2016 D&C capital expenditures were $423.7 million for 251 (201.2 net) wells
Cresent Point reported its average daily production in Q3 of 176,069 boe/d, an increase of more than 15,000 boe/d from Q3 2016. Its previously reported one-mile Wasatch well continues to flow at approximately 1,000 boe/d and produced more than 200 mboe in 125 days. Additionally, the company recently completed a one-mile Uteland-Butte with a 60 day flow rate of approximately 640 boe/d (90% liquids).
